Subject: DR drill next Thursday — Trackhopper webhook

Hey Lina — before you review my branch, heads up: we're running the disaster-recovery drill on the Trackhopper parcel-tracking webhook Thursday. The plan is to kill the primary relay in Norvik, let failover pick up, and replay two hours of delivery events. My PR adds the replay guard, so please eyeball the dedupe logic. During the drill, whoever unseals the standby relay will need to enter the recovery passphrase shown below.

unlock words, hahip-baduf: holwyn-istath-julvan

# Plugin authors: please read before modifying this file.
# Since the Querra 4.2 release, the Marlow query planner has shown a
# regression where nested join hints are silently dropped when plugins
# register custom scan operators. Until the fix lands in 4.2.3, keep
# MARLOW_PLANNER_COMPAT=legacy set below, and avoid issuing hinted
# queries from plugin init hooks. The compat mode requires the planner
# to authenticate against the Querra hint registry. The credential for that registry connection is set on the next line.

env line for yahip-tafog: RELAY_SECRET3=4ca

Subject: Gaugewright sidecar cut-over complete

Hi — the metrics-aggregation sidecar cut-over finished last night. All services on the Dunmore cluster now emit through Gaugewright instead of the legacy pusher. Aggregate counts matched the shadow run within 0.1%, and the legacy path is disabled but not yet removed pending your review of the removal PR. To make the diff easier to check, the sidecar's live configuration is included below.

deployment values, kajep-kageg:
[praix]
host = praix.paliqcorp.corp
user = praix_svc
database = praix_prod

## v2.9.0 — Export memory fix

Spreadsheet exports in Tallygrid now stream rows directly to the output buffer instead of materializing the full workbook in memory. Peak usage for a 500k-row export drops from ~3.2 GB to ~180 MB. The old builder remains behind export.legacy_mode for one release cycle, then gets removed. Watch the exporter_rss metric after deploy. Future maintainers should direct questions about this change to the engineer named below.

named custodian: Brivan Eliath Quenox Frador